Depression in the elderly is an overlooked problem. This course is designed for care staff who wish to increase their understanding of depression in the elderly and to develop the appropriate skills to help clients overcome the debilitating problem of depression.
Program
Course objectives/key benefits:
By the end of the course delegates will understand and be able to recognise clinical depression in the elderly, as well as being able to develop effective treatment and care programmes for elderly clients with depression.
Who the course is aimed at:
Anyone who works with the elderly.
Course content:
· Understanding depression in the elderly
· Causes of depression in the elderly
· Recognising depression in the elderly
· Treatment and nursing care of elderly clients with depression
